背景情况:
- 骨髓瘤是最常见的恶性骨瘤,在青春期之前很少见.
- 在青少年前和青少年骨髓瘤之间,临床行为可能会有所不同.
研究的目的:
- 为了比较青春期前和青春期患者的骨髓瘤特征.
- 识别诊断,治疗和结果的潜在差异.
主要方法:
- 对骨质肉瘤患者的回顾性研究.
- 青春期前和青春期前群体之间的比较.
- 分析诊断间隔,转移,手术,放弃治疗和生存.
主要成果:
- 在前青少年和青少年 (12周) 中,诊断间隔较短 (7周).
- 诊断时的转移,肢体挽救手术率或治疗放弃率没有显著差异.
- 两组的总体存活率相似.
结论:
- 在青春期前,骨髓瘤的诊断间隔显著缩短.
- 需要进行更大规模的研究,以充分阐明前青少年和青少年之间骨髓瘤特征的差异.

Tumor progression is a phenomenon where the pre-formed tumor acquires successive mutations to become clinically more aggressive and malignant. In the 1950s, Foulds first described the stepwise progression of cancer cells through successive stages.
Colon cancer is one of the best-documented examples of tumor progression. Early mutation in the APC gene in colon cells causes a small growth on the colon wall called a polyp. With time, this polyp grows into a benign, pre-cancerous tumor. Further...

Cancer therapies are various modes of treatment, such as surgery, radiation therapy, and chemotherapy that are administered to cancer patients.
However, cancer treatments can pose several challenges, as therapies used to kill cancer cells are generally also toxic to normal cells. Moreover, cancer cells mutate rapidly and can develop resistance to chemical agents or radiation therapy. Besides, all types of cancer cells may not respond to the same therapy.
